Join Canadian Canoe Museum Curator, Jeremy Ward for a live online members-only talk from the comfort of your home on Wednesday, July 18th @ 7:00pm (EST).

Jeremy will explore how our Canadian Canoe Museum exhibits come to be developed and look at our newest exhibit
Canoes to Go: The Search for a Truly Portable Boat.

One of the things you will quickly learn from Canoes to Go is that tying a conventional craft on a roof rack is patently uncreative relative to the other crazy things that paddlers and canoe manufacturers have done over the years to take canoes with them on their travels.
